Form 144 is a document that investors must file with the government when they plan to sell a large number of shares of a company's stock. It helps ensure transparency so everyone knows how many shares are being sold and when, which can impact the stock's price.

Shares granted to an individual that carry limits on transfer or sale until certain conditions are met, such as staying with the company for a set time or hitting performance targets. Think of them as a locked gift that gradually opens; for investors they matter because they affect how many shares may enter the market later, signal management incentives and potential dilution, and reveal confidence in future company performance.

Performance shares are a type of company stock given to executives or employees that only become theirs if the company meets specific goals, like hitting certain profits or growth targets. They motivate leaders to work toward the company’s success, because their additional shares depend on achieving these results.
